Thanks for the wise council!Peter, The special pliers freehand system for making hooks and eyebolts has never worked for me. If you’re using it and find it tiring, try two nails with their heads clipped off in a block of wood clamped securely in a vise.
My system for making any and all small fittings is to avoid moving parts.
